前端性能优化的方式包括哪些

2024-03-07 14:21   SPDC科技洞察   

一、前端性能优化的重要性

随着互联网的快速发展,用户对网页的体验要求越来越高。前端性能的好坏直接影响到用户对网页的响应速度和满意度。因此,前端性能优化对于提升用户体验和网站运营效果具有重要意义。

二、前端性能优化的方式

1. 减少HTTP请求

减少HTTP请求是提升前端性能的重要手段。可以通过合并CSS和JavaScrip文件、使用CSS Sprie、引入外部文件的顺序等方式来减少HTTP请求。

2. 使用CD加速

CD加速可以加快网页的加载速度,通过将静态资源放到离用户最近的CD节点上,让用户更快地获取到资源。

3. 压缩JavaScrip和CSS

压缩JavaScrip和CSS可以减少文件大小,加快网页的加载速度。常见的压缩方式包括Gzip压缩和UglifyJS压缩。

4. 使用浏览器的缓存机制

通过设置HTTP缓存机制,可以让浏览器在一段时间内复用之前请求的资源,减少HTTP请求次数。

5. 优化图片大小和质量

图片是网页中占用资源最多的文件类型之一,可以通过优化图片大小和质量来减少网页的加载时间。

6. 使用异步加载和延迟加载技术

异步加载和延迟加载技术可以让非关键资源在页面加载后再加载,减少页面加载时间。

三、前端性能优化的工具和技术

1. Yslow工具

Yslow是一款免费的网页性能分析工具,可以帮助开发者分析网页加载速度和优化建议。

2. Google PageSpeed工具

Google PageSpeed是Google提供的一款网页性能分析工具,可以帮助开发者优化网页性能。

3. WebPageTes工具

WebPageTes是一款开源的网页性能测试工具,可以帮助开发者测试网页在不同浏览器和网络环境下的性能表现。

四、前端性能优化的最佳实践案例

1. 案例一:某电商网站优化前后端性能,提升用户体验和订单转化率。该电商网站在用户浏览商品页面时,通过合并CSS和JavaScrip文件、使用CD加速、压缩JavaScrip和CSS等技术手段,提高了页面加载速度和响应速度,从而提升了用户体验和订单转化率。同时,通过使用异步加载和延迟加载技术,将非关键资源在页面加载后再加载,减少了页面加载时间。经过优化后,该电商网站的页面加载速度和响应速度得到了显著提升,用户满意度和订单转化率也得到了明显提高。

2. 案例二:某新闻网站优化图片大小和质量,提高网页加载速度和用户体验。该新闻网站在用户浏览文章页面时,通过优化图片大小和质量,减少了图片加载时间和流量消耗,提高了网页的加载速度和用户体验。同时,通过使用浏览器的缓存机制,让浏览器在一段时间内复用之前请求的资源,减少了HTTP请求次数,进一步提高了网页的性能和响应速度。经过优化后,该新闻网站的页面加载速度和用户体验得到了明显提高,用户满意度也得到了提升。

五、总结与展望

前端性能优化是提升用户体验和网站运营效果的重要手段。通过减少HTTP请求、使用CD加速、压缩JavaScrip和CSS、使用浏览器的缓存机制、优化图片大小和质量以及使用异步加载和延迟加载技术等方式,可以显著提高网页的性能和响应速度。同时,结合最佳实践案例,我们可以看到前端性能优化对于提高用户体验和订单转化率以及提升新闻网站的用户满意度具有重要意义。未来,随着互联网技术的不断发展和用户需求的不断变化,前端性能优化将会更加注重用户体验和响应速度的提升,同时也将会更加智能化和个性化。因此,我们应该不断探索和学习新的前端性能优化技术和方法,以满足用户的需求并提升网站的性能表现。

相关阅读

  • 前端性能优化的方式包括哪些

    前端性能优化的方式包括哪些

    一、前端性能优化的重要性 随着互联网的快速发展,用户对网页的体验要求越来越高。前端性能的好坏直

  • 前端框架的好处

    前端框架的好处

    以前端框架的八大好处:从提升开发效率到优化性能 =======================

  • dg丝绒玫瑰香水

    dg丝绒玫瑰香水

    DG丝绒玫瑰香水:一种感官的盛宴 在繁忙的都市生活中,寻找一款适合自己的香水往往能带来一种独特

  • vue生产环境

    vue生产环境

    Vue.js 是一个流行的 JavaScrip 框架,用于构建用户界面。Vue.js 提供了开发环境

  • React与Redux的高效集成

    React与Redux的高效集成

    Reac与Redux的高效集成:构建现代化前端应用的强大工具组合 在现代的前端开发中,Reac

  • vue和react的不同

    vue和react的不同

    Vue.js 与 Reac:两种不同的生成方式 在前端开发的世界里,Vue.js 和 Reac

  • 响应式网页ui设计规范

    响应式网页ui设计规范

    响应式网页UI设计规范 ============在创建响应式网页用户界面(UI)时,需要考虑到

  • css的框架

    css的框架

    这是一个使用CSS框架生成文章的基本示例。在这个示例中,我们将使用一个非常流行的CSS框架——Boo

  • angular单体测试

    angular单体测试

    Agular单体测试:构建更可靠的Web应用程序 在开发Web应用程序时,确保代码的质量和可靠

  • 前端的安全问题

    前端的安全问题

    前端安全问题:概述、防范与应对策略一、前端安全问题概述 随着互联网的快速发展,前端安全问题日益